Low resolutions with 3070Ti not possible? It was working fine with 2070
My PC is plugged in a Multisync CRT
Before i change my graphics card to a 3070Ti, i was using a 2070 with a DP to VGA adapter and CRU and i was able to display resolutions from 320x240 to 1280x1024 fine.
Now i've switched to a 3070Ti, with same adaptator and CRT, and i can't get resolutions below 480p, or they are corrupted (bad sync). I use the same CRU profile
Custom resolutions appears and i can select 320x240 with quickres but the display is corrupted, bad vsync i think, it's unreadable

I've tried to patch the driver for limits but it's the same.

Is there a low pixel clock limit on NVIDIA 3000 series ?

Any idea how i can force 320x240 like it was with the 2070

I've disabled DSR and set no scaling to screen in NVIDIA panel (as it was with my 2070 ) but it still doesn't work with the 3070ti
